Notes

Superscribed on p. 35 by S. Pye, E. Hody, J. Andree, J. Fothergill, D. Ross, J.B. Silvester and other licentiates.
Attributed to Pye by Munk and by G. N. Clark. History of the R. C. P., v. 2, p. 556n.
Copy 2. Supplier/Donor: Med. Soc. Lond. Bound with: Some remarks on the charter of the College of Physicians in London. 1714. This book was formerly part of the collection of the Medical Society of London, which was deposited for safekeeping in the Wellcome Library in 1964. It was eventually purchased by the Wellcome Trust in 1984, with assistance from the National Heritage Memorial Fund and other charities.
